- package schema
- import (
- "sort"
- "strconv"
- "strings"
- )
- type Index struct {
- Name string
- Class string // UNIQUE | FULLTEXT | SPATIAL
- Type string // btree, hash, gist, spgist, gin, and brin
- Where string
- Comment string
- Option string // WITH PARSER parser_name
- Fields []IndexOption
- }
- type IndexOption struct {
- *Field
- Expression string
- Sort string // DESC, ASC
- Collate string
- Length int
- priority int
- }
- // ParseIndexes parse schema indexes
- func (schema *Schema) ParseIndexes() map[string]Index {
- var indexes = map[string]Index{}
- for _, field := range schema.Fields {
- if field.TagSettings["INDEX"] != "" || field.TagSettings["UNIQUEINDEX"] != "" {
- for _, index := range parseFieldIndexes(field) {
- idx := indexes[index.Name]
- idx.Name = index.Name
- if idx.Class == "" {
- idx.Class = index.Class
- }
- if idx.Type == "" {
- idx.Type = index.Type
- }
- if idx.Where == "" {
- idx.Where = index.Where
- }
- if idx.Comment == "" {
- idx.Comment = index.Comment
- }
- if idx.Option == "" {
- idx.Option = index.Option
- }
- idx.Fields = append(idx.Fields, index.Fields...)
- sort.Slice(idx.Fields, func(i, j int) bool {
- return idx.Fields[i].priority < idx.Fields[j].priority
- })
- indexes[index.Name] = idx
- }
- }
- }
- return indexes
- }
- func (schema *Schema) LookIndex(name string) *Index {
- if schema != nil {
- indexes := schema.ParseIndexes()
- for _, index := range indexes {
- if index.Name == name {
- return &index
- }
- for _, field := range index.Fields {
- if field.Name == name {
- return &index
- }
- }
- }
- }
- return nil
- }
- func parseFieldIndexes(field *Field) (indexes []Index) {
- for _, value := range strings.Split(field.Tag.Get("gorm"), ";") {
- if value != "" {
- v := strings.Split(value, ":")
- k := strings.TrimSpace(strings.ToUpper(v[0]))
- if k == "INDEX" || k == "UNIQUEINDEX" {
- var (
- name string
- tag = strings.Join(v[1:], ":")
- idx = strings.Index(tag, ",")
- settings = ParseTagSetting(tag, ",")
- length, _ = strconv.Atoi(settings["LENGTH"])
- )
- if idx == -1 {
- idx = len(tag)
- }
- if idx != -1 {
- name = tag[0:idx]
- }
- if name == "" {
- name = field.Schema.namer.IndexName(field.Schema.Table, field.Name)
- }
- if (k == "UNIQUEINDEX") || settings["UNIQUE"] != "" {
- settings["CLASS"] = "UNIQUE"
- }
- priority, err := strconv.Atoi(settings["PRIORITY"])
- if err != nil {
- priority = 10
- }
- indexes = append(indexes, Index{
- Name: name,
- Class: settings["CLASS"],
- Type: settings["TYPE"],
- Where: settings["WHERE"],
- Comment: settings["COMMENT"],
- Option: settings["OPTION"],
- Fields: []IndexOption{{
- Field: field,
- Expression: settings["EXPRESSION"],
- Sort: settings["SORT"],
- Collate: settings["COLLATE"],
- Length: length,
- priority: priority,
- }},
- })
- }
- }
- }
- return
- }
